15146 ZIP Code — Monroeville, PA
Allegheny County, Pennsylvania
ZIP code 15146 is located in
Monroeville ,
Pennsylvania ,
within Allegheny County .
It covers approximately 19.62 square miles and serves a population of
28,551 residents.
This is a po box 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one,
served by area code 412 .
About ZIP code 15146
The housing stock consists of a mix of housing types. Most homes were built in the 1950s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$182,700. Owner-occupancy sits near the national average at 71%.
Median household income is $80,727. 37%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.
The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 27 minutes is near the national average.
Educational attainment is high — 46%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national average of 33%.
